MBA Operations Management at Hindustan University is a degree designed to prepare students for success as operations managers in a variety of industries. The MBA Operations Management online degree will cover topics such as process analysis, quality control, lean manufacturing principles, supply chain management, and logistics. Especially, MBA Operations Management at Hindustan University students will gain an understanding of the importance of operations management to the success of an organization through exploring the techniques and tools used to help organizations run more efficiently. Additionally, the MBA Operations Management online will also discuss the concept of metrics, systems design, and the use of technology in operations management.

Eligibility for MBA Operations Management:

  • Eligibility for an MBA in Operations Management at Hindustan University can vary depending on the specific requirements set by individual universities or business schools. 
  • A bachelor’s degree from an accredited university or other educational facility is required of all applicants. Any discipline is acceptable for the degree, while some universities might choose students with management, science, or engineering backgrounds.
  • Many MBA programs, such as those in Operations Management, prefer students with some work experience. The required work experience may vary but is typically around 2-5 years. 

Generally, for the subjects covered in an MBA Operations Management, the curriculum typically includes a combination of core business subjects and specialized courses related to operations. The subjects in MBA Operations Management online are listed below:

  • Inventory Management
  • Production Planning and Control
  • Business Analytics
  • Strategic Management
  • Financial Management
  • Leadership and Organizational Behavior
  • Operations Management
  • Supply Chain Management
  • Logistics Management
  • Quality Management
  • Project Management
  • Operations Research
  • Lean Six Sigma

What is operations management in MBA?

Operations management in MBA focuses on overseeing and optimizing various business processes to ensure efficient production, delivery, and quality control.

What are the roles after MBA in operations management?

After completing an MBA operations management, graduates can pursue roles such as operations manager, supply chain manager, logistics coordinator, or production planner.

What is the salary of MBA in operations management?

MBA Operations Manager salary in India ranges between ₹ 2.7 Lakhs to ₹ 18.9 Lakhs with an average annual salary of ₹ 6.9 Lakhs.
